Applications
4'-Methoxyacrylophenone (CAS 7448-86-4) is used as an odorant and fragrance intermediate in perfumery, and may be incorporated into cosmetic and household product formulations as a fragrance component; owing to its acrylate moiety, it can serve as a reactive monomer or intermediate in UV-curable coatings, inks, and adhesives, and it also functions as a building block for the synthesis of aroma-related compounds and specialty polymers. Its use is subject to local regulations and formulation limits.
